Jessie Albert Dental & Orthodontic Center Receives Grant from the Northeast Delta Dental Foundation

November 4, 2015

Bath, Maine – Jessie Albert Dental & Orthodontic Center in Bath, a program of Catholic Charities Maine, is the recipient of a $5,000 grant from the Northeast Delta Dental Foundation. The funds will enable the Center to invest in its technology by purchasing a new Intraoral Camera.

The Jessie Albert Dental & Orthodontic Center is committed to providing state-of-the-art dental care for all in the spirit of its founder, a local mother in need of affordable dental care for her children. The purchase of this equipment will allow the Center to capture best-in-class images of patients’ oral issues to help them see areas of concern and make informed decisions on recommended treatment plans.

“We are most appreciative of this grant and of Northeast Delta Dental Foundation’s support of our mission to provide high-quality services, including the latest technology, to all members of the community, regardless of their ability to pay,” says Stephen P. Letourneau, CEO of Catholic Charities Maine.

“The Northeast Delta Dental Foundation has been awarding grants to oral health initiatives in Maine since 1995. We look for community-based programs making dental care and oral health education more accessible. We appreciate the opportunity to help the Jessie Albert Dental & Orthodontic Center achieve its mission,” said Kathleen B. Walker, Treasurer of the Foundation.
